In this episode of the IELTS Energy podcast, Aubrey and Lindsay discuss whether grammar or supporting ideas is more important for achieving a high band score in the IELTS writing section. They analyze the grammar and task response scoring criteria, highlighting that while grammar is essential, it often takes a significant amount of time to improve. They suggest focusing on developing and supporting ideas effectively, as this can lead to a higher task response score and boost the overall writing score, even with grammar that is not perfect. The hosts provide examples of underdeveloped and well-supported ideas, emphasizing the importance of using specific details and examples, including personal experiences, to substantiate arguments in the essay.
